The longlist for BBC Radio 1’s Sound of 2024 has been revealed, tipping ten new artists for success next year.

This year’s longlist has been chosen by a panel of over 140 industry experts and artists, including Olivia Rodrigo, Declan McKenna, Chase & Status, Mahalia and more.

The acts are (in alphabetical order):

Ayra Starr
Caity Baser
CMAT
Elmiene
Kenya Grace
The Last Dinner Party
Olivia Dean
Peggy Gou
Sekou
Tyla

Last year girl group FLO were crowned the winner ahead of a strong longlist featuring the likes of Fred again.., Asake, Dylan and Cat Burns. Artists named on the list over the years include Stormzy, Adele, Lady Gaga, Dizzee Rascal, The Weeknd, Dua Lipa, Billie Eilish and Lewis Capaldi.

The countdown of the Top 5 will kick off across Radio 1 on Monday 1 January 2024. The winner will be revealed on Friday 5 January 2024 on Radio 1.

Radio 1 will also host a special event – BBC Radio 1 Sound of 2024 Live – which will be held at Maida Vale on Monday 8 January with performances from artists on the longlist. The application for tickets is now open on the BBC Shows and Tours website.

The list was compiled using recommendations from 149 influential music experts, including artists, DJs, radio and TV producers, journalists, streaming experts and festival bookers. All were asked to name their favourite three new acts, who could be performers from any country and any musical genre, whether or not they are signed. They cannot have been the lead artist on a UK number 1 or number 2 album or more than two UK top ten singles before 12 October 2023. They also must not already be widely known by the UK general public (for example, a member of a hit band going solo or a TV star) or have appeared on the Sound Of… list before.
